The successful candidate will be responsible for undertaking a varied caseload of environmental protection work, including the investigation and resolution of statutory nuisance complaints such as noise, odour, smoke, and other environmental impacts. You will carry out site inspections, gather evidence, liaise with residents and businesses, and take appropriate enforcement action where necessary. A strong understanding of relevant legislation and the ability to manage complex casework independently are essential.
Applicants must hold a relevant qualification in Environmental Health, Acoustics, or a closely related discipline. Demonstrable experience in environmental protection, particularly in nuisance investigation and enforcement, is required.
